Football coaches now have a guide to refer to in the hope of leading them to the top of the world game, Ghana Football Association President, Kwesi Nyantakyi says.The GFA President has tasked the new generation of coaches to draw inspiration from the book, ‘Principles of Modern Soccer Coaching’, authored by FIFA and Caf instructor, Ben Koufie.The 26-chapter book, made up of 174 pages takes a detailed look into the coaching profession as it gives an insight on all aspects of the game including research, training, preparation, tactics and systems."This book is a celebration of one of the greats of Ghana football. His thoughts on the game reminds all of us of a genius all-round football man," said Kwesi Nyantakyi at the launch of the first coaching book by a Ghanaian as he praised the quality contribution of the 80-year-old former Ghana Football Association Chairman, Ben Koufie."It's a book laden with experience. We welcome the documentation of experiences and this book sets the trend of how coaching in Africa has developed."It's a befitting legacy bequeathed to the football family. I hope it can be an inspiration to the new generation of coaches."The first copy, autographed by Ben Koufie was bought by renowned businessman and a member of the football family, Dr Kofi Amoah for Ghc 10,000.
